— The Northern Colorado Owlz are no more. The Windsor-based minor league baseball team will be replaced by a new team, the Colorado Springs Sky Sox, to complete the 2025 season.
The team played only two home games this season before resigning, and their future in Northern Colorado remains uncertain. The Northern Colorado Owlz minor league baseball team is no more.
